Egg Freezing Explained: Why Both Egg Quality And Quantity Matter For Women Planning The Future

Show Quick Read

Key points generated by AI, verified by newsroom

With more women choosing to delay motherhood due to career goals, personal reasons or health concerns, egg freezing has emerged as an important option for preserving fertility. However, as interest in this medical procedure grows, many women find themselves confused by two commonly used terms, egg quality and egg quantity. While the phrases may sound similar, their meaning and impact on fertility outcomes are quite different, making it essential to understand both before making a decision.

Why Egg Freezing Is Gaining Popularity

Fertility preservation through egg freezing is increasingly being considered by women who wish to keep their reproductive options open. According to medical experts, decisions related to fertility are deeply influenced by age, lifestyle and overall reproductive health. While some women believe that having a higher number of eggs automatically increases the chances of pregnancy, others assume that quality alone is sufficient. Specialists clarify that although both factors are important, they do not carry equal weight in every situation.

Dr Madhu Goyal, from the Department of Obstetrics and Gynaecology at Fortis Hospital, Greater Kailash, explains that understanding the difference between egg quality and quantity helps women set realistic expectations and make informed choices regarding fertility preservation.

What Does Egg Quality Really Mean?

Egg quality refers to how healthy an egg is internally. A good-quality egg contains the correct number of chromosomes, which is essential for successful fertilisation and the development of a healthy embryo. Dr Goyal notes that egg quality gradually begins to decline after the age of 30, increasing the risk of chromosomal abnormalities. This decline can affect both pregnancy outcomes and embryo development. Eggs frozen at a younger age tend to survive the thawing process better and offer higher chances of a successful pregnancy.

Understanding Egg Quantity Or Egg Count

Egg quantity refers to the total number of eggs present in the ovaries. This is usually assessed through blood tests measuring Anti-Müllerian Hormone levels or through ultrasound scans. While it is natural for egg count to decrease with age, having a higher number of eggs does not necessarily mean they are all healthy. In some cases, women may have a high egg count with lower quality, while others may have fewer eggs that are healthier.

Quality vs Quantity: What Matters More?

In egg freezing, egg quality is generally considered slightly more important. A single healthy egg has a better chance of fertilisation than multiple weaker ones. However, quantity cannot be ignored, as not every frozen egg survives thawing or develops into an embryo. This is why doctors often recommend freezing multiple eggs to improve the likelihood of success.
